"As part of the deal to resume these talks, Israel agreed to release 104 long-term Palestinian prisoners, in phases, as a so-called “confidence-building” measure and to encourage progress. Most of the prisoners have nearly completed their sentences. The first 26 were freed on 13 August, 11 to the West Bank and 15 to Gaza. Confidence? Progress? The same buzzwords were used about the Oslo accords two decades ago. Has no lesson been learned? As Addameer notes, “over 23,000 Palestinians have been released since 1993 as ‘goodwill measures’ during various negotiations and peace talks. However, in that same period, at least 86,000 Palestinians have been arrested, including children, women, disabled persons and university students.” Currently Israel holds more than 5,000 Palestinian prisoners. Such “confidence-building measures” are a sham!"
